The life of Frank Lentini (birth name Francesco) is a vivid example of how you can overcome any ailment and find the strength to enjoy life without giving up in front of piled up difficulties. During his life, Frank experienced a lot: in infancy, his parents abandoned him, he was taken up by an aunt who did not have children of her own, but also could not bear life with such a special child.

The third leg went to Frank Lentini from his twin brother

Image
Image

Frank was the 12th child in an ordinary Sicilian family, he was born with three limbs. Such an anomaly was formed due to the fact that the 13th twin brother did not disconnect from him. "In memory" of him, the boy received not only an extra leg, but also another deformed foot with one toe (Frank had 16 toes in total) and another reproductive organ. The child suffered greatly from the inconveniences that "foreign" organs caused him, but gradually he learned to live in his own body.

When the aunt dropped her hands and handed the boy over to the Internet for disabled children, a fateful event took place in his life. Frank lived for a long time with blind children, as well as with those who did not have arms or legs at all. The main thing that he understood for himself during the time spent in the boarding school is that there are people in the world who live much worse than him.

The motivation to live and enjoy every day was so strong that Frank took up physical training. He learned to run and jump rope on his three legs, hit a soccer ball and act like he was no different from ordinary people.

When Frank was 8 years old, his parents decided to emigrate to America and took all their children with them. On a steamer that sailed across the ocean, Frank's father received an offer to send his son to the circus. The man did not agree, as he considered such an attitude towards his own son unacceptable. To be fair, my father tried to atone for his guilt in front of Frank and gave him the opportunity to get a university education. The guy was gifted, learned four foreign languages, was comprehensively developed. The personal life of Frank Lentini also developed, he married a girl who sincerely fell in love with him, they had four healthy children.

Lentini joined the circus troupe many years later, this decision was voluntary. To make his performances lively and interesting, he mastered juggling, learned several acrobatic tracks, knew how to ride a bicycle and ice skates, and mastered playing musical instruments. On circus posters he was called "the king of freaks", but his fellow artists called him simply "king", because his performances always made a real sensation, and he himself was a very pleasant and intelligent person. Lentini toured until his death.
